Output 21c9ad5244ee83442f4a047dc3a511e1ddccdd333e8a520176dd1cfc7635b1e9:62

value
130658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ea3021f46c4ea2768aeeda4b2d7a5d7694a2b041 OP_EQUAL
address
3P3HhkEcAHXzGToxxQ3CS9uog3T78jXEZd
transaction
21c9ad5244ee83442f4a047dc3a511e1ddccdd333e8a520176dd1cfc7635b1e9
spent
true